Mates4Mates

Mates4Mates provides a way forward for current and ex-serving Australian Defence Force members and their families experiencing service-related physical injuries, mental health issues, and isolation.

We support veterans and their families through our psychological and physical rehabilitation and wellbeing services, social connection activities, and skills for recovery programs.

Psychological services

Providing evidence-based individual and group therapy, our highly skilled team of psychologists are here to help with challenges such as trauma, depression, anxiety, addiction, and relationship issues.

Physical rehabilitation and wellbeing services

A range of physical rehabilitation and wellbeing services are delivered in individual and group settings. Our qualified exercise physiologists understand how a balanced approach to recovery can be lifechanging.

Social connection activities

Knowing the power of social connection and community, the team creates opportunities for mateship and peer support through social, recreational, and family activities.

Skills for Recovery Programs

Designed to provide veterans and their families with opportunities, both online and in-person, to develop new skills and learn techniques to help them move forward from the impacts of service.

Whether you are a veteran, are currently serving, or are a family member of someone who has served – you can access support if you have been impacted physically or psychologically by your service. We provide a safe, supportive environment for you to seek help with no judgement or expectation.

We host a variety of social connection activities across the state, as well as online.

Our online social connection activities provide those needing support with the opportunity to form meaningful connections with others, no matter where they are in the world. Some current online social connection activities include weekly coffee catch-ups, monthly trivia evenings, school holiday craft programs, and short creative activities such as painting, photography, and cooking courses.

Who this service is for

Current and ex-serving Australian Defence Force members and their families impacted by service.

Cost

All our services are offered at no-cost to eligible Mates and family members, thanks to the generous support of our community and partners.

Opening Hours

The Family Recovery Centre is open from 8.30am to 4.30pm, Monday to Friday.
